Princess Kate made a sensational return to the BAFTAs.
The Prince and Princess of Wales attended the 2023 EE British Academy Film Awards this afternoon, where they appeared on the red carpet for the first time in three years. This year, Kate continued her tradition of wearing white dresses to the esteemed ceremony, while adding a bit of edge with some surprising accessories.
The royal ensemble consisted of a one-shoulder goddess-style dress by Alexander McQueen that she previously wore at the ceremony 2019, with an additional back sash decoration on his left shoulder. She teamed up with black velvet opera gloves, matching William’s velvet double-breasted jacket.

Kate also wore a rectangular black clutch to match the gloves and finished the look with a pair of drop earrings adorned with rose gold petals.
Along with the velvet piece, William’s sleek iteration of the traditional tuxedo included black dress pants, a white shirt and a black bow tie.
For their last appearance at the prestigious awards ceremony, in 2020, the then Cambridges followed the evening suggested dress code promote sustainability. Kate re-wore a white and gold Alexander McQueen look she previously wore in 2012. She accessorized the short-sleeved dress with gold Jimmy Choo PumpsA Anya Hindmarch coverand a Van Cleef & Arpels mother-of-pearl necklace and matching earrings.
Meanwhile William, who has been president of the British Academy of Film and Television Arts since 2010, looked dapper in a classic black tuxedo and bow tie.
